Indulgent Peach and Cardamom Dump Cake – Effortless Delight

Discover the joy of Peach and Cardamom Dump Cake, a simple yet decadent dessert that brings summer flavors into your home.

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 40 minutes
Total Time 50 minutes
Servings 8 slices
Calories 250kcal

Equipment

  • 9x13 baking dish

Ingredients

For the Filling

  • 2 cans Canned Peaches with juice for optimal flavor
  • 1 teaspoon Ground Cardamom adjust to taste

For the Topping

  • 1 box Yellow Cake Mix can substitute with vanilla or spice mix
  • 1/2 cup Cold Butter cut into small pieces
  • 1/2 cup Brown Sugar for caramel sweetness

Optional Add-Ins

  • Nuts chopped pecans or walnuts
  • Oats rolled oats for a heartier texture

Instructions

Preparation

  •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C) and grease a 9x13 baking dish.
  • Pour two cans of canned peaches (with juice) into the greased baking dish.
  • Sprinkle the ground cardamom over the peach mixture.
  • Layer the yellow cake mix evenly over the peach and cardamom mixture.
  • Distribute cold butter cut into small pieces evenly across the cake mix.
  • Bake for 35-40 minutes until the top is golden brown and bubbly.

Notes

Serve warm with a scoop of vanilla ice cream for an extra treat. Canned peaches yield the best flavor for this recipe.
